9. Bea Arthur's Truck-Driving Marine Past
December 10: Bea Arthur served 30 months in the Marine Corps during World War II, driving a truck and working as a typist, according to website The Smoking Gun.
8. Stem Cell Transplant Patient Free of HIV
April 2: A patient with HIV remains free of the virus after receiving a stem cell transplant from a donor with a gene mutation that confers natural resistance to the virus that causes AIDS.
7.50 Cent Encourages Gay Suicide
September 30: No stranger to antigay tweets, 50 Cent posted an ill-timed message Thursday on his Twitter page, suggesting that any man who isn't into women should kill himself. The rapper now claims he has "nothing against people who choose [an] alternative life."
6. Lesbian Students Stopped From Graduating
November 15: Two female high school students in Oklahoma fire back at their school for refusing to let them graduate after discovering the two are a couple.
5. Megachurch Pastor Jim Swilley Comes Out
October 29: The pastor of a megachurch in Conyers, Ga., told his congregation that he's gay, saying that while he knows his announcement might ruin his career, the recent rash of suicides pushed him to speak out.
4. Marquette Students Rally for Shunned Professor
May 6: Marquette University students protested one of the biggest faculty events of the year in solidarity with a prospective dean whose job offer was allegedly rescinded because she is a lesbian.
3. Fran Drescher: My Ex-Husband is Gay
June 2: Fran Drescher has long been a vocal supporter of gay rights, but as she reveals in the new issue of In Touch, her dedication runs deep: Her former husband, to whom who she was married for 21 years, is gay.
2. School Official Wants Gays Dead
October 26: Arkansas school board member Clint McCance posts on Facebook that he believes "queers" and "fags" should kill themselves -- that is, if they don't get AIDS and die first.
1. McMillen: I Was Sent to Fake Prom
April 5: Constance McMillen confirmed to The Advocate that she was sent to a "fake prom" while the rest of her class partied at a secret location at a parent-organized event.
